Step 3: Choose a Business Model

Your business model shapes how you operate. Here are popular options:

E-commerce

Sell physical products via platforms like Shopify or Amazon.

Dropshipping

Don’t stock inventory—sell items from suppliers who ship for you.

Digital Products

E-books, courses, or printables are scalable and high-margin.

Affiliate Marketing

Earn commissions by promoting others’ products.

Step 6: Develop a Marketing Plan

Content Marketing

Write blogs, create videos, or start a podcast to attract an audience.

Social Media Strategy

Leverage Instagram, Facebook, TikTok, or LinkedIn to engage your audience.

Email Marketing

Capture leads and nurture them with platforms like Mailchimp or ConvertKit.

Step 7: Leverage SEO to Drive Traffic

Search engine optimization (SEO) is your secret weapon. When people Google questions related to your niche, make sure your site pops up!

Basic SEO Tips

  • Use keywords naturally in your content.
  • Optimize meta titles and descriptions.
  • Build backlinks from reputable sources.

Step 8: Set Up Payment Systems

You’ll need a way to get paid, right? Use trusted platforms like PayPal, Stripe, or Square to handle transactions securely.

FAQs

1. What’s the best online business for beginners?
The best business depends on your skills and interests. Popular options include dropshipping, freelancing, and affiliate marketing.

2. Do I need a lot of money to start an online business?
No, many online businesses require minimal investment. You can start with as little as a domain and hosting fees.

3. How long does it take to succeed in an online business?
Success varies, but consistency and effort often lead to results within 6-12 months.

4. Do I need technical skills to start?
Not necessarily. Many tools make the process beginner-friendly, and you can always learn or outsource technical tasks.

5. What’s the best platform for e-commerce?
Shopify is highly recommended for its ease of use and scalability, but WooCommerce and BigCommerce are also excellent options.
